Dominion Energy is looking for an intern for the Solar Project Construction group. This intern will apply technical and project management skills to the large-scale buildout of Virginia solar renewable infrastructure to meet the rising demand for energy across the region. The group is responsible for managing solar projects from development and design through procurement, permitting, construction, and closeout. Position is primarily stationed out of the downtown Richmond, VA office with opportunities to visit local solar project construction sites throughout the term. Candidate will have opportunities to learn and become familiar with: • Project Management: oversight of scope and schedule and coordination with key internal stakeholders (e.g., Business Development, Real Estate, Safety, Project Controls, Operations, and Environmental). • Technical aspects of solar site design: performing reviews of preliminary site environmental and cultural studies, civil site plans, stormwater design, electrical distribution, equipment qualification/selection, and solar array layouts. • Risk evaluation: identifying potential risk events, determining project impacts, and developing mitigation strategies. • Permitting: tasks required to obtain zoning and land disturbance permits to begin construction. • Contract Management: oversight of contracted engineering products and/or verifying construction adherence to the site design during construction.
